The aviation fuel market size is expected to see rapid growth in the next few years. It will grow to $499.86 billion in 2030 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 13.7%. The growth in the forecast period can be attributed to adoption of sustainable aviation fuel mandates, expansion of low cost carriers, modernization of military aircraft fleets, growth in private and business aviation, investments in aviation fuel supply chain resilience. Major trends in the forecast period include shift toward sustainable aviation fuel blending, rising demand for high performance turbine fuels, growth in military grade fuel standardization, increasing focus on fuel quality and safety compliance, expansion of aviation fuel storage and logistics infrastructure.
The growth of air transportation worldwide is fueling the expansion of the aviation fuel market. The increasing population and rising earnings among the middle class have significantly boosted the demand for air travel in both developed and developing nations. As air travel rises, the demand for aviation fuel correspondingly increases, as it is an essential requirement for aircraft operations. For instance, the International Air Transport Association (IATA), a trade association based in Canada, reported that in 2023, revenue passenger kilometers (RPKs) increased by 36.9% compared to 2022. Overall, global traffic for the entire year of 2023 reached 94.1% of pre-pandemic levels. In December 2023, total traffic rose by 25.3% compared to December 2022. Thus, the growing air transportation sector is expected to drive the aviation fuel market.
Major companies operating in the aviation fuel market are innovating new technologies, such as ethanol-based sustainable aviation fuel technology, to increase their profitability in the market. Ethanol-based Sustainable Aviation Fuel (eSAF) is a type of renewable and sustainable alternative fuel designed for use in aviation. They can significantly lower the carbon footprint of air travel and aid in meeting environmental targets set by the aviation industry. For instance, in September 2023, Lummus Technology, a US-based company that provides process technologies, catalysts, and related engineering and project management services for the refining, petrochemical, gas processing, and renewable industries, launched ethanol-based sustainable aviation fuel technology. It is derived from ethanol, which is typically produced from plant-based feedstocks such as corn, sugarcane, or other agricultural residues. The production process involves converting these feedstocks into ethanol, which can then be further processed into eSAF. The technology offers operators a large-scale, economically proven way to lower greenhouse gas emissions from the aviation sector.
In March 2024, Southwest Airlines Company, a U.S.-based airline, acquired SAFFiRE Renewables, LLC for an undisclosed amount. Through this acquisition, Southwest Airlines aims to enhance its sustainable aviation fuel (SAF) capabilities by gaining direct access to SAFFiRE’s technology, which converts agricultural residues into renewable ethanol that can be upgraded into SAF, supporting long-term aviation decarbonization goals. SAFFiRE Renewables, LLC is a U.S.-based company specializing in renewable ethanol production and sustainable aviation fuel conversion technologies.
